食管癌血清和尿液中血管内皮生长因子水平的变化及其意义

摘    要:目的检测食管癌患者术前血清和尿液中血管内皮生长因子(VEGF)水平,探讨VEGV与食管癌的关系及其临床意义.方法应用酶联免疫吸附法(ELISA)对82例食管癌患者术前血清和尿液中VEGF水平进行测定,并对其进行对照分析.结果食管癌患者术前血清和尿液VEGF水平分别为(92.81±5.86)ng/L和(277.92±22.71)ng/L,明显高于正常人组(P<0.01).食管癌组术前尿液VEGF水平与肿瘤的分化程度、侵袭程度、临床分期及淋巴结转移等密切相关(P<0.05);且术前尿液组的VEGF水平明显高于术前血清组(P<0.01).结论VEGF可能参与食管癌的发生、发展和转移过程的调控,尿液VEGF含量的增强,预示食管癌的转移和预后不良.

Change in vascular endothelial growth factor level in serum and urine of esophageal carcinoma patients

Abstract:OBJECTIVE: The purpose of this study was to determine the serum and urine vascular endothelial growth factor (VEGF) level in patients with esophageal carcinoma and to elucidate their significance of pre-operative VEGF levels. METHODS: Urine VEGF level was measured by sandwich ELISA in 82 esophageal carcinoma patients and 15 healthy individuals. RESULTS: The serum and urine VEGF levels (mean +/- s, ng/L) in esophageal carcinoma patients were 92.81 +/- 5.86 and 277.92 +/- 22.71 which were significantly higher than those of healthy subjects (16.01 +/- 3.46 and 15.27 +/- 4.22, P < 0.01). The pre-operatiive urine VEGF level in esophageal cancer patients were significantly higher in advanced stage of the disease (P < 0.01). As to the depth of invasion (T-factor), the urine VEGF level of T4 invasive lesions were significantly higher than those with T1-T3 invasion (P < 0.01). The same was also true in esophageal carcinoma having lymph node metastasis than that without (P < 0.05). The urine VEGF level was significantly higher than the serum VEGF level (P < 0.01). CONCLUSION: VEGF plays an important role in the growth and metastasis of esophageal cancer.
